Responsibilities

Fosters relationships with residents and their families with the goal of providing them with spiritual leadership and
direction. Assists residents and their families with the planning, organization, implementation, and evaluation of a
religious program to attend to residents' spiritual needs.

  • Establishes personal relationships with residents and their families; provides encouragement to the
    residents and staff at the community.
  • Spends time with those expressing a desire to grow in their relationship with God.
  • Encourages communication and fellowship among residents.
  • Provides weekly non-denominational worship, including administration of communion. Leads and
    fosters weekly non-denominational Bible studies and devotions within the community.
  • Works with other staff members to encourage application of Christian principles in the rendering of
    care.
  • Conducts one-on-one visits with each of the residents at least once a month or as needed. Visits
    those residents who have temporarily transferred for hospital care or rehabilitation.
  • Monitors participation in worship and related activity programs.
  • Alerts the Executive Director of any change in residents’ behavior.
  • Works with life enrichment coordinator/specialist in coordinating activities for the residents.
  • Attends family council meetings and other family support meetings as requested. Acts as
    facilitator at family support group meetings.

Qualifications

Education and Experience
Completion of undergraduate work in a related field is required. Completion or pursuance of a masters-level
degree in Christian ministry from an accredited seminary is preferred. A course concentration in ministry to senior
adults is desirable.


Certifications, Licenses, and other Special Requirements
Ordained or seeking to be ordained from a recognized Christian denomination is preferred, but not required.


Management/Decision Making
Applies existing guidelines and procedures to make varied decisions within a department. Uses sound judgment and
experience to solve moderately complex problems based on precedent, example, reasonableness or a combination
of these.


Knowledge and Skills
Possesses extensive knowledge of a distinct skill or function and a thorough understanding of the organization and
work environment. Has working knowledge of a functional discipline.
